The following general safety precautions and warnings apply.
Before attempting to use the equipment, it is important that all danger and caution
indicators are reviewed.
If the equipment is used in a manner not specified by the manufacturer or functions
abnormally, proceed with caution. Otherwise, the protection provided by the
equipment may be impaired and can result in impaired operation and injury.
Hazardous voltages can cause shock, burns or death.
Installation/service personnel must be familiar with general device test practices,
electrical awareness and safety precautions must be followed.
Before performing visual inspections, tests, or periodic maintenance on this device or
associated circuits, isolate or disconnect all hazardous live circuits and sources of
electric power.
Failure to shut equipment off prior to removing the power connections could expose
you to dangerous voltages causing injury or death.
Ensure that all connections to the product are correct so as to avoid accidental risk of
shock and/or fire, for example from high voltage connected to low voltage terminals.
Follow the requirements of this manual, including adequate wiring size and type,
terminal torque settings, voltage, current magnitudes applied, and adequate isolation/
clearance in external wiring from high to low voltage circuits.
Use the device only for its intended purpose and application.
